An Advanced Certificate in EV Charging Speeds Planning and Development is increasingly significant in the UK's rapidly evolving electric vehicle (EV) market. The UK government aims for all new car sales to be zero-emission by 2030, driving substantial growth in EV adoption. This necessitates robust infrastructure planning to address range anxiety and ensure sufficient charging provision. Currently, the UK lags behind other European nations in public charging infrastructure deployment, highlighting a crucial skills gap. According to recent data, only approximately 30,000 public charging points exist nationwide. This contrasts with the projected need for hundreds of thousands of chargers to support the anticipated increase in EV ownership. Effective EV charging speeds planning, encompassing network design, location optimization, and power management, is paramount.
